Advances in anti-arthritic agents. 24-25 January 2000, London, UK
1Current Drugs Ltd, Middlesex House, 34-42 Cleveland Street, London, W1P 6LB, UK. Hannah.Brown@cursci.co.uk
Abstract:
This meeting provided an excellent overview of the field of arthritis, although most of the drugs mentioned were designed to treat rheumatoid arthritis. There was an air of excitement surrounding the event because, after a substantial period of dormancy in clinical rheumatology, there are now many promising new treatments emerging, which, it is hoped, will greatly improve the quality of life for numerous arthritis sufferers. Speakers covered topics as diverse as care for sufferers, impact of the disease, status of current treatments, and approaches for the future. The majority of the presentations were drug-oriented; the speaker generally gave a summary of their company's arthritis research program and then followed this with a case study of its lead compound.

Antibody Structure
Antibodies, also known as immunoglobulins (Ig), are essential players of the adaptive immune system. These antigen-binding proteins are produced by B cells and make up 20 percent of the total blood plasma by weight. In mammals, antibodies fall into five different classes, which each elicits a different biological response upon antigen binding.
